Truffle Dog Name Meaning

The name Truffle carries a sophisticated charm, reflecting its origins in the culinary world.

  • Origin: Truffle is derived from French, where it refers to a highly prized edible fungus, historically associated with luxury and gourmet cuisine.
  • Literal meaning: Its direct translation is the "truffle" mushroom, a delicacy revered for its distinctive earthy scent and flavor.
  • Cultural significance: While there are no famous human bearers, the name itself evokes a sense of gourmet appreciation and refined taste.
  • Why it works for dogs: The name is short, distinct, and has a soft yet clear sound, making it easy for a dog to learn and respond to.
  • Pronunciation: Pronounced "Truf-fle," it has two clear syllables and is generally not mispronounced.

Truffle Dog Name Breed Matches

The name Truffle perfectly suits dogs with a touch of elegance, French heritage, or those known for their discerning noses.

  • French Bulldog: This breed pairs wonderfully with Truffle, honoring its French origin and the breed's charming, often comical, personality.
  • Standard Poodle: An elegant and intelligent breed with French roots, the Standard Poodle embodies the sophisticated essence of the name Truffle.
  • Lagotto Romagnolo: Known as the traditional Italian truffle-hunting dog, this breed is a literal and perfect match for the name Truffle due to its historical role.
  • Basset Hound: With its distinctive long ears and incredible sense of smell, this French breed could be a whimsical and fitting choice for a dog named Truffle.
